I used to rush through my evenings — always planning, always preparing for the next thing. But over time, I realized peace isn’t something we find at the finish line. It’s something we create, moment by moment, especially in the quiet.

The end of the day is more than rest — it’s reflection.

It’s the small prayer whispered before bed, the gentle forgiveness of yourself, and the deep exhale that tells your spirit, “You did enough.”

A soft ending doesn’t mean weakness — it’s wisdom. It’s choosing calm over chaos, stillness over striving. 

For me, this looks like writing down three things I’m grateful for, lighting a candle, and releasing everything I can’t control into God’s hands.

That’s where peace begins — not in perfection, but in presence.

Maybe peace is the real kind of progress after all. When you end softly, you begin the next day stronger.🤍
